Honor
from 5 reviewer videos

Reviewers praise

  • Display quality is a recurring strength across the lineup — reviewers note exceptional brightness, vibrant AMOLED panels, and thin bezels that rival far more expensive rivals
  • Camera systems punch well above their tier, with large sensors, capable ultra-wide lenses, and AI-assisted zoom that partially compensates for the absence of telephoto glass on base models
  • Build quality is described as genuinely premium — slim profiles, solid frames, frosted glass backs, and high IP ratings for water and dust resistance appear consistently across the range

Reviewers push back

  • Magic OS software divides reviewers — its Huawei-era DNA is described as polarising, feeling familiar to some and cluttered or foreign to others, especially Western users
  • Base models in each series compromise on telephoto hardware, and while AI zoom compensates in daylight, performance degrades significantly at night or offline
  • Honor's reputation in Western markets remains damaged by association with Huawei, and some reviewers note that a segment of potential buyers will not return to the brand regardless of hardware quality
this is a worldclass smartphone that could give Apple Google or Samsung a serious run for their money if people bought it
Android Police · best for Honor suits buyers who want flagship-grade display brightness, solid build quality, and versatile cameras and are comfortable with a Chinese-origin Android skin and Google's ecosystem rather than a Western software experience.

Where reviewers split on Honor: Reviewers disagree on how fully AI super-zoom replaces a dedicated telephoto lens — one reviewer finds it impressive enough to match optical competition in daylight, while another notes it softens noticeably when zooming on base modelsThe Huawei-era software legacy is framed positively by one reviewer as a return to a beloved camera experience, and negatively by another as a polarising skin that could make or break the purchaseOne reviewer is emphatic that Honor hardware competes with flagship-tier devices across the board; another is more measured, noting it keeps up at its price point without claiming outright dominance
